Results for Spanish Word For Stay

Loading Results
Related Searches
spanish word for stay
spanish word for stray
spanish word for star
spanish word for stairs
spanish word for state
spanish word for stadium
spanish word for stapler
spanish word for statue
spanish word for stamp
spanish word for stain
Loading Additional Information